New Century Initiative 2015 General Election Report



2015 general elections in Nigeria marked another democratic change in government. Democracy in Nigeria has come to stay and this time around all the major stakeholders in the election process demonstrated full commitment to ensure that 2015 election in Nigeria was a success as it serves as a guide, motivation and model for other African nations. New Century Initiative as an organization working on election process, democracy, development and good governance in Nigeria and also as INEC domestic observer during the 2015 elections has come up with this observation report which we believe can contribute positively to future elections in Nigeria.

INDEPENDENT NATIONAL ELECTORAL COMMISSION (INEC)

PRESS STATEMENT
Further to the allegation made by the All Progressives Congress (APC) on the conduct of the Presidential and National Assembly elections on Saturday 28th March, 2015 in Rivers state and its call for the cancellation of the exercise, the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C) has set up a fact finding mission to ascertain the veracity of the claims and allegations and to advice the Commission and the Chief Electoral Commissioner/Returning Officer for the Presidential election.
The committee of National Electoral Commissioners comprises the following:
Mrs. Thelma Iremirem – Head and supervisory National Commissioner for Rivers state.
Col. M.K Hammanga – Member
Professor Lai Olurode – Member
They have departed for Rivers state and it is expected that they will submit their report before the end of the collation of results of the other states and the FCT.
Following the consideration of the report, the Commission will make its decision known.
Issued this 30th Day of March, 2015.
